Eula Jurgensen

   Eula A. Jurgensen, 90, passed away Tuesday, Aug. 22, 2006 at the Gladwin Pines Nursing Center. She was born on Feb. 11, 1916 in Dowagiac, Michigan to the late Ben and Orpha Delle (Wilbraham) Johnson.

   She married John Jurgensen on April 14, 1939 in Dowagiac. She graduated from Dowagiac High School and attended Western Michigan University, which was referred to then as Western State Teachers College. She was a retired bank teller, and she loved to paint. Eula was a member of Gladwin Free Methodist Church.

   She is survived by her husband, John; four children, Michael (Marsha) Jurgensen of Kingsley, Janice (James) Decker of Starvation Lake, Michigan, John (Jean) Jurgensen of Gladwin, and Melissa (Gerry) Cholger of Traverse City; grandchildren and Great-grandchildren, Mike and Linda Jurgensen and Dylan, Josh and Logan of Granger, Indiana, Shawn and Deanna Jurgensen and Samantha and Shawn of Traverse City, Tobin and Carolyn Decker and Spencer and Scott of Indianapolis, Mathias and Krystin Decker of Indianapolis, John and Lynette Jurgensen of Grand Rapids, Katie and Jonathon Ruse and Ellaina and Benjamin of New Era, Michigan, Cathy and Dave Sommerfield and Nicholas of Traverse City, Tami and Paul Roeske and Marissa and Jared of Traverse City, and David and Dankel Cholger of Traverse City; one brother, Lynn and Evelyn Johnson; several nieces and nephews; and her dear friend, Jane Anne Billings. She was predeceased by her parents; one sister, Letha Paxton; and a brother, Kenneth Johnson.

   Memorial services were on Saturday, Aug. 26, 2006 at Gladwin Free Methodist Church with Pastor Phillip Hortop officiating. In lieu of flowers the family requests that memorials be made to the Gladwin Free Methodist Mission Fund. The Sisson Funeral Home was in charge of arrangements.
